Historically P&I Risk Stand Alone Pollution Policy Required Due
To Pollution Exclusions In Hull and P&I Policies
Older Forms Exclude By Endorsement e.g., SP23 & SP38
Newer Forms Exclude It Within Body Of Policy
Pollution Buyback A – Limited Coverage
Key Provisions
• Strict Liability Statute (Spilling Vessel Responds Without Regard to Fault)
• Responsible Party Liable For– Removal Costs & Expenses 33 USC § 2702(b)(1)– Damages 33 USC § 2702(b)(2)(A-F)
A) Natural Resources; B) Real or Personal Property; C) Subsistence Use; D) Revenues; E) Profits & Earning Capacity; and F) Public Services
• Loss Of Right To Limit Liability 33 USC § 2704(c)(2)(C)
Pollution Insuring Clauses Do Not Address Removal Of Hull
Covers Pollutant Removal Costs & Damages
Avoids Coverage Duplication Keeps Premiums Lower Lack Of Hull/P&I Coverage Is A Material
Pollution Underwriting Consideration
Relevant Insuring Clauses
Hull Policy - Sue & Labor ClauseAnd in case of any Loss … it shall be lawful and necessary for the Assured … to sue, labor and travel for … the defense, safeguard and recovery of the Vessel …
P&I Policy – Removal Of Wreck Cost or expense of, or incidental to, any attempted or actual removal or disposal of obstructions, wrecks or their cargos under statutory power or otherwise pursuant to law, PROVIDED, however, that there shall be deducted from such claim for costs or expenses, the value of any salvage from the wreck inuring to the benefit of the Assured or any subrogee thereof.
• Port of Portland v. Water Quality Insurance Syndicate, 796 F.2d 1188 (9th Cir. 1986)
• Kearny Barge Co. v. Global Insurance Company, 943 F.Supp. 441 (D.N.J. 1996)
• Quigg Brothers-Schermer, Inc. v. Commercial Union, 223 F.3d 997 (9th Cir. 2000)
• American Home Assurance Co. v. Fore River Dock & Dredge, 321 F.Supp.2d 209 (D.Ma. 2004)
